DECLARATION
_______________________________________________________
(Name of applicant), being hereby warned that willful false statements and the
like so made are punishable by fine or imprisonment, or both, under Section
1001 of Title 18 of the United States Code and that such willful false
statements may jeopardize the validity of the application or any registration
resulting therefrom, declares that:
1. __________ (he or she) believes __________
(himself or herself) to be the owner of the trademark sought to be
registered;
2. To the best of (his or her) knowledge and
belief no other person, firm, corporation or association has the right to use
the mark in commerce, either in the identical form or in such near resemblance
thereto as may be likely, when applied to the goods of such other person to
cause confusion, or to cause mistake, or to deceive;
3. The facts set forth in this application are
true;
4. All statements made in this application of
(his or her) own knowledge are true and all statements made on information and
belief are believed to be true; and
5. These statements were made with the
knowledge that willful false statements and the like so made are punishable by
fine or imprisonment, or both, under Section 1001 of Title 18 of the United
States Code and that such willful false statements may jeopardize the validity
of the application or document or any registration resulting therefrom.
